Japanese Restaurants in Grand Rapids
Grand Rapids, Michigan, is a hidden gem for Japanese food enthusiasts, boasting a unique blend of local flavors and authentic dining experiences. The city's proximity to Lake Michigan and the surrounding countryside has influenced a distinct style of Japanese cuisine, often referred to as "Michigan-Style Japanese." This fusion combines the traditional flavors of Japan with locally sourced ingredients, such as fresh fish and Michigan-grown produce.
Locals can find a variety of Japanese restaurants in Grand Rapids, ranging from casual sushi bars to upscale hibachi steakhouses. The city's main dining districts, such as the West Michigan Avenue corridor and the Grand Rapids Downtown Market, offer a range of Japanese eateries. Some popular local styles and trends include modern Japanese cuisine, featuring creative twists on traditional dishes, and izakayas, which serve a variety of small plates and craft cocktails. Whether you're in the mood for sushi, ramen, or teppanyaki, Grand Rapids has something for every Japanese food lover.

What types of dishes do Japanese restaurants typically offer?
Common dishes served at Japanese restaurants:
- Sushi and sashimi
- Ramen and udon
- Tempura and teriyaki
- Donburi and bento boxes
- Seasonal specialties and desserts
